Singapore CIOs ahead in digital transformation with prompt investments

Friday, May 23rd, 2014

Singapore CIOs are well ahead in maturity and adoption level of digital transformation with prompt investments to support top-line growth while driving productivity and innovation developments to meet demands.

Findings of NCS SURF Emerging Technologies Maturity Index 2014, a research commissioned by NCS (conducted by IDC) to evaluate Singapore companies’ adoption of emerging technologies in Big Data, Digital Engagement and Smart Computing (M2M).

Findings of NCS SURF Emerging Technologies Maturity Index 2014, a research commissioned by NCS (conducted by IDC) to evaluate Singapore companies’ adoption of emerging technologies in Big Data, Digital Engagement and Smart Computing (M2M).

Digital transformation – how it is managed and applied is becoming increasingly important to how business succeed in today’s economy.

“CIOs need to work closely with business stakeholders to increase work space productivity and collaboration. They should take advantage of real time intelligence to enhance service delivery and operational excellence,” said Lai Weng Yew, Vice President of Business Application Services of NCS.

A recent survey from NCS’ SURF Emerging Technologies Maturity Index 2014 polled 240 senior information technology (IT) executives found that a majority (75%) of their organisations are well ahead of technology investments, citing Digital Transformation as an extremely important or important contributor of their companies’ worldwide strategy.

Singapore businesses acknowledged the benefits of using multiple technology assets.

SAP HANA powers McLaren’s F1 real time race strategy

Thursday, September 12th, 2013

The Formula 1 Grand Prix is again in Singapore for the only night race in the F1 circuit.

I had the opportunity to take a peek at how SAP’s HANA in-memory computing system helps McLaren to harness the Big Data streaming in from their cars’ onboard sensors to fine-tune – in real time – the team’s race strategy.

SAP HANA provides McLaren with a dashboard for comprehensive awareness and decision making.

SAP HANA provides McLaren with a dashboard for comprehensive awareness and real time decision making during a Formula 1 race or practice.

In this digital age of high performance computing, pertinent telemetry data is constantly being captured and transmitted by on-board sensors on the car for modelling and analysis by the team management back in the control room – be it during test practices, qualification runs, or the actual race itself.

ActuateOne and BIRT onDemand integrated with Amazon Redshift

Wednesday, May 8th, 2013

This integration is another addition to Actuate’s rapidly growing stable of ActuateOne connectors for Big-Data-ready data sources that enable developers, IT departments and OEMs to deliver world-class BI applications.

The ActuateOne platform empowers developers to rapidly develop custom, BIRT-based business analytics and customer communications applications, and provides analytic self-service for data-savvy users of BIRT Analytics.

The ActuateOne platform empowers developers to rapidly develop custom, BIRT-based business analytics and customer communications applications, and provides analytic self-service for data-savvy users of BIRT Analytics.

ActuateOne is Actuate’s BIRT-based suite of commercial products for development and deployment of custom business analytics applications, while BIRT onDemand is Actuate’s SaaS version of ActuateOne.

“When integrated with Amazon Redshift, ActuateOne users are suddenly able to scale data at the same rate as ActuateOne scales users,” said Jeff Morris, VP of Product Marketing at Actuate.

Actuate announced today that both have been integrated with Amazon Redshift – AWS’s new petabyte-scale cloud warehouse service.

ActuateOne offers fast visualisation and rich analysis features while Amazon Redshift brings to the table its performance, scalability and low cost (under US$1,000/terabyte/year).

Combining the two enables organizations of all sizes to reap the benefits of ultra-fast access and near-speed-of-thought visualization for Cloud-based business analytics – on real-time Big Data workloads of any size or complexity.
